Now this place, he remembered intimately for a number of reasons. Goku couldn't feasibly count the number of times Taura, Birdy, and he had come through here to get to the basement. Most of the time they had been stopped by someone or something lurking in here. The memory started his heart pumping with excitement. It had been a long time since he had a proper fight!
The one with Birdy didn't count. Goku thought back further and stopped on the time he had attacked Kibitoshin in this exact room. He tried, but he couldn't remember why he had wanted to defeat the man... Either way, it had been a great fight. It was also the night he had truly met Taura and everything she was capable of. Yeah, those were all fond memories!
Welp. Goku flicked his gaze back and forth within the spacious room, but nothing seemed willing to assault him. That was a real drag!
"Ah well..." Technically, he had a job to complete. Reluctantly, he peeled his feet off the carpet and moved to the doors that lead into the main hallways. He could there'd be a lot of people out there to throw these bricks at.

...But more concerning than knowing the route was the Sun Room itself, as Zero was very quick to find out.
What the-? He halted at the doors immediately, briefly holding one arm out as a way to stop his allies in case they hadn't noticed right away. Something had been here - or, if they were unlucky, was still here. If the scorch marks all over the place were any clue, it had probably been a fire breathing monster of some kind, and it might have already gotten into a fight with some other prisoners. Just what they needed to deal with right now...
Zero scanned the room multiple times trying to see if he could spot any shapes that might be creatures rather than chairs, but wasn't able to see anything unusual. If the monster was still here, then it was good at hiding. But maybe they could slip past unnoticed if they were careful? Zero would prefer that, especially if it meant avoiding this unnecessary fight...

Such caution was proved the moment Sechs entered the Sun Room just behind Zero and Aigis. The traces of a blazing battle were clear within the darkness. Seeing the severity of the burns left Sechs feeling just a little disappointed -- he obviously had missed a pretty good fight by a few minutes...
However, that aforementioned fight may not have been over though. As much as Sechs loved a good tussle, it was the last thing they needed here. Like his companions, Sechs scanned the room as keenly as he could but he knew he couldn't totally trust his senses at night. Not when imaginary shadows were being forced into his vision by the drug. He had to depend on his instincts and the reactions of Zero and Aigis. When nothing dangerous seemed to be detected by his allies, Sechs took the risk and stepped forward into the open.
When nothing pounced forth from the darkness, Sechs signaled to the others with a jerk of his head before moving on, stooping low to avoid possible detection as he made his way to the cafeteria.
